Renovations are a great way to increase the capital value of your property. Any amount of time spent in renovation doesn’t go in vain, as affluent buyers always scramble for a property that looks new and well-furnished.

A quick example of increasing the property value as well as salability and rent ability is adding a garage or car port. If the property has the space to add a car shelter and it does not have one, future buyers or tenants will see the added value. When you rent a property you can often recover the cost of the work from a tenant within two years. After that the extra rent you charge will be pure profit. On top of the rent amount if you are making additional changes to the property at the same time, your bank will take the improvements into consideration when you get the property revalued.

Home renovation is an elaborate affair that includes everything from painting the outside walls of the house to repairing the electrical cables, and also improving the decor of the rooms. The entire concept of renovation revolves around making the house both more functional and more cosy for its residents. A 50% increase in property value is not unheard of through an elaborate makeover.

Any good renovation must primarily aim at enhancing the looks of a property. The interiors of your restored property must be more in line with the latest style so that potential buyers, who are often conscious of the current trends in interior design, feel pleased and are ready to pay a high sum for it.

Professional consultation of a qualified interior design expert is a must for better renovation. If limited renovation is what you are aiming at, then the interior designer can suggest which sections of your house can be cleverly redesigned to attract prospective buyers.

For instance, an interior design expert knows how to generate good results by adding a few architectural details at minimal expense. With stylish designs for floors and well chosen colours for walls, one can create the feeling of space and light in the interiors. Moreover, when it comes to improvements to be made in the general structure and dire need for strength and support of the foundation, no one can give timely advice to the owner better than an interior designer does. From his experience, he will be able to make recommendations on the basis of your budget and likings.

An interior designer can also suggest to you which renovation materials are long-lasting and inexpensive at the same time. Purchasing the materials and appliances at discounted prices is something that is best handled by these people. They can also tell you how much time would be needed for the whole refurbishing project to finish.

The buyers’ current tastes and likings must also be found out from an experienced property broker who has all the information about the changing trends in the property market. After all, the whole objective of the renovation is to please them to be able to fetch a bigger price for the property.
